Partnering with a managed service provider (MSP) that specializes in the financial sector delivers measurable returns. These benefits go beyond simple tech support, directly addressing the core operational, security, and financial challenges that accounting firms face daily.
An expert MSP implements robust security controls tailored to financial regulations. They help you protect sensitive client data with advanced threat detection, access controls, and data encryption, which are essential for preparing for audits like SOC 2 and maintaining compliance with standards like the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act (GLBA).
Proactive, 24/7 monitoring and support prevent IT issues from disrupting critical periods like tax season or quarter-end reporting. Unplanned IT downtime can cost small businesses over $10,000 per hour, a figure that underscores the value of preventative maintenance and rapid response to keep your systems online and your staff productive.
Flat-fee pricing models convert unpredictable capital expenditures and emergency repair costs into a fixed monthly operational expense. This approach makes budgeting simpler and more reliable, eliminating surprise invoices and allowing for better long-term financial planning.
Leverage virtual Chief Information Officer (vCIO) services for strategic planning, technology roadmaps, and IT budgeting. This gives your firm executive-level expertise to align technology with business goals without the significant expense of hiring a full-time executive.
Outsourcing IT management allows your partners, accountants, and support staff to concentrate on billable hours and client relationships. Instead of troubleshooting software glitches or network issues, your team can focus on what it does best: serving clients and growing the firm.

Managed IT for accounting firms goes beyond basic support. It includes specialized expertise in financial software, data security protocols for sensitive information, and assistance with industry-specific compliance frameworks like SOC 2.
Flat-fee pricing provides all-inclusive IT support, monitoring, and security for a predictable monthly cost. This converts IT into a stable operational expense, eliminating surprise invoices for repairs or support calls and simplifying your budgeting process.
Yes, a qualified MSP can implement and manage the technical controls required by regulations like GLBA. They can also help you prepare for compliance audits, ensuring client data is handled securely according to legal and professional standards.
Many firms use a co-managed IT model where an MSP supplements in-house staff. An MSP can provide 24/7 monitoring, advanced cybersecurity tools, and strategic expertise, freeing your team to focus on daily operational needs and user support.
